'use client' import React from 'react' import { observer } from 'mobx-react-lite' import { IframeManager } from '@app/managers' import { Box } from '@a11ywatch/ui' import { GrMultimedia, GrStatusWarning, GrTestDesktop } from 'react-icons/gr' import { issueExtractor } from '@app/utils' import { Button } from './buttons' import { useInteractiveContext } from '../providers/interactive' const btnStyle = 'w-full py-3 place-items-center bg-[rgba(20,20,20,0.3)] border-3' const MFab = observer(({ iframeStore, issue, marketing }: any) => { const { setMiniPlayerContent, miniPlayer } = useInteractiveContext() const pageIssues = issueExtractor(issue) const onViewIssuesModal = () => { setMiniPlayerContent(!miniPlayer.open) } return ( {!marketing ? ( ) : null} {pageIssues?.length ? ( ) : null} ) }) export const Fab = ({ issue, marketing }: any) => ( )